Our take

Tolu opens with a bright, almost citrusy snap of juniper and clary sage, but the orange blossom quickly steers it into a powdery white floral haze. The heart is a soft bouquet of orchid, rose, and lily-of-the-valley that feels more like a memory of flowers than the real thing, cushioned by the balsamic warmth beneath. As it dries down, the tolu balsam and amber fuse with tonka into a sweet, resinous skin scent, with olibanum adding a faint smoky edge. The overall character is that of an antique vanity drawer lined with velvet, holding dried petals and a chip of amber resin, both dusty and intimate.

This is a quiet, almost shy fragrance. The longevity is decent at a moderate three and a half hours, but the sillage stays close, barely a whisper after the first hour. It leans sweet and powdery without being cloying, and there is a subtle synthetic edge in the florals that keeps it from feeling like a true naturalist composition. It suits someone who wears fragrance for themselves, not for the room, and who appreciates the restrained elegance of early aughts niche. Skip it if you demand beast mode projection or prefer crisp, green scents. It shines best in the cooler months, on a still autumn afternoon or a wintry evening by the fire, when you want to feel wrapped in a soft, resinous glow.
